Skip to content Skip to footer

Analyst: Wynn Stock Represents a Good Risk-Reward

In a recent analysis, J.P. Morgan’s Joseph Greff highlighted Wynn Resorts’ stock as a compelling investment opportunity, despite its recent underperformance. Greff’s assessment points to the company’s ongoing projects and strategic positioning as key factors that make Wynn a good risk-reward proposition. This analysis comes at a time when macroeconomic conditions have overshadowed the potential of individual companies, making it crucial for investors to look beyond short-term market fluctuations.

Strategic Projects and Market Position

Wynn Resorts has several strategic projects underway that bolster its market position. One of the most notable is the resort project in the United Arab Emirates, which is expected to open in 2027. This project represents a significant investment for Wynn, with $514 million already committed. The resort is anticipated to generate substantial revenue, adding to Wynn’s diversified portfolio. Additionally, the expansion of the convention center in Las Vegas is expected to drive higher margins and improve EBITDA, further strengthening Wynn’s financial outlook.

The company’s strategic positioning in key markets like Las Vegas and Macau also plays a crucial role in its risk-reward profile. Despite the challenges posed by the Macau market, Wynn’s diversified revenue streams and strong brand presence provide a buffer against market volatility. This strategic positioning allows Wynn to capitalize on growth opportunities while mitigating risks associated with market fluctuations.

wynn resorts stock analysis

Moreover, Wynn’s management has been proactive in addressing market challenges and exploring new opportunities. This proactive approach, combined with the company’s robust financial health, positions Wynn well for future growth and stability.

Financial Performance and Valuation

Wynn Resorts’ financial performance has been a focal point for analysts. Despite a 17% decline in stock value year-to-date, the company’s underlying financial health remains strong. Greff’s analysis points to a sum-of-the-parts valuation approach, which suggests a price target of $101 by 2025. This valuation takes into account Wynn’s assets, including its Las Vegas and Encore Boston Harbor properties, as well as its stake in Wynn Macau.

The company’s financial performance is further supported by its diversified revenue streams. Wynn’s operations in Las Vegas and Boston have shown resilience, contributing to steady cash flows. Additionally, the anticipated recovery in the Macau market is expected to boost Wynn’s overall financial performance. This recovery, coupled with the company’s strategic investments, underscores the potential for significant upside in Wynn’s stock value.

Greff’s analysis also highlights the importance of Wynn’s investor relations efforts. The upcoming investor day in October is expected to provide detailed insights into the company’s strategic initiatives and financial outlook. This transparency and engagement with investors are crucial for building confidence and driving long-term value.

Market Sentiment and Future Outlook

Market sentiment towards Wynn Resorts has been mixed, influenced by broader economic conditions and sector-specific challenges. However, Greff’s analysis suggests that the current market sentiment does not fully reflect Wynn’s potential. The company’s strategic projects, strong financial health, and proactive management approach position it well for future growth.

The ongoing developments in the UAE and the expansion of the convention center in Las Vegas are expected to drive significant revenue growth. These projects, combined with the anticipated recovery in the Macau market, provide a strong foundation for Wynn’s future performance. Additionally, Wynn’s diversified portfolio and strategic positioning in key markets offer a buffer against market volatility.

Looking ahead, Wynn’s management is focused on executing its strategic initiatives and delivering value to shareholders. The company’s proactive approach to market challenges and commitment to growth are expected to drive long-term value. As such, Wynn represents a compelling investment opportunity with a favorable risk-reward profile.

Leave a comment

0.0/5